Earn Elite Status

Joining American Airlines’ AAdvantage loyalty program is a crucial step towards earning upgrades. Elite members receive priority access to upgrades based on their status level. By accumulating miles and achieving higher tiers, you can increase your chances of being upgraded.

Use Upgrade Certificates

American Airlines offers upgrade certificates as a reward for elite members or through promotions. These certificates allow you to upgrade your seat to a higher class of service. The number of certificates you need depends on the flight and the class of service you’re upgrading to.

Other Tips for Upgrading

  • Check in early: Early check-in increases your chances of being upgraded as the gate agents may have more flexibility to accommodate upgrade requests.
  • Be polite and respectful: A positive attitude and courteous demeanor can make a difference in the upgrade process.
  • Dress professionally: While not a guarantee, dressing well can convey a sense of importance and increase your chances of being noticed for an upgrade.
  • Travel during off-peak seasons: Flights during peak travel times are more competitive for upgrades. Consider traveling during off-peak periods to improve your chances.
  • Fly on less popular routes: Flights on popular routes tend to have more upgrade requests. Opting for less popular routes can increase your odds of securing an upgrade.
